/** |
|
* Recursively searches for elements matching the selector, piercing Shadow DOM. |
|
* @param {string} selector - The CSS selector to match. |
|
* @param {Element|ShadowRoot} rootNode - The node to start searching from. |
|
* @returns {Element[]} An array of found elements. |
|
*/ |
|
function deepQuerySelectorAll(selector, rootNode = document.documentElement) { |
|
const results = []; |
|
const elementsToSearchIn = [rootNode]; |
|
|
|
while (elementsToSearchIn.length > 0) { |
|
const currentElement = elementsToSearchIn.shift(); |
|
if (!currentElement || typeof currentElement.querySelectorAll !== 'function') { |
|
continue; |
|
} |
|
|
|
// Search in the light DOM of the current element |
|
results.push(...Array.from(currentElement.querySelectorAll(selector))); |
|
|
|
// Search in the shadow DOM of all children of currentElement |
|
const shadowHosts = currentElement.querySelectorAll('*'); |
|
for (const host of shadowHosts) { |
|
if (host.shadowRoot) { |
|
// Add shadowRoot itself to search inside it. |
|
// Its children's shadowRoots will be processed from shadowHosts. |
|
results.push(...Array.from(host.shadowRoot.querySelectorAll(selector))); |
|
elementsToSearchIn.push(host.shadowRoot); // Also queue the shadowRoot for deeper traversal of its children's shadowRoots |
|
} |
|
} |
|
} |
|
return results; |
|
} |
